Understanding the Competition in North Carolina

North Carolina’s growing economy has led to a crowded market of technology providers. Most competitors fall into one of these categories:

  • Cabling-only contractors
  • Security system installers
  • IT service providers
  • Electrical or utility contractors

While these companies may perform well in their specific niche, businesses often need multiple vendors to complete a single project. This can lead to:

  • Communication gaps
  • Project delays
  • Integration issues
  • Increased management complexity

Managed Services: Reactive vs. Proactive Support

Support services vary widely among providers.

Competitors Typically Offer:

  • Break-fix (reactive) support
  • Limited monitoring
  • Slower response times

Instrata’s Managed Services Provide:

  • Proactive monitoring and maintenance
  • Early issue detection
  • Faster resolution times
  • Predictable monthly costs

This proactive approach reduces downtime and improves overall system performance.
